Nixa Pullover
Notes
A colorwork round yoke pullover belongs in every winter
wardrobe. A cozy and toasty design, perfect for wearing near the fire and protecting from the harsh elements.
Finished Measurements
Bust: 32 (35 ¼, 38 ¾, 42, 45 ½, 48 ¾, 52 ¼, 55 ½, 59)” / 81.5 89.5, 98.5, 106.5, 115.5, 124, 132.5, 141, 150 cm
Yarn
Stone Wool Cormo
(100% Wyoming/Cormo wool; approx 200yd 182m/100g)
MC: Tobacco 01, 4 (4, 5, 5, 6, 6, 6, 7, 7) skeins
CC1: Ozark 03, 1 skein
CC2: Ozark 02, 1 skein
CC3: Ozark 01, 1 skein
Needles
US 6 4.0 mm for rib trim: 32” / 80 cm and 16” / 40 cm circs and DPNs, if you don’t use the Magic Loop method
US 7 4.5 mm for main body: 32” / 80 cm circ and DPNs, if you don’t use the Magic Loop method or size needed to obtain gauge
Notions
Stitch Markers
Waste Yarn
apestry Needle
Gauge
19 sts and 29 rnds = 4” / 10 cm in colorwork and stockinette with larger needles, after blocking
